Output 95bce2465c3bdc97e1b23f34b5b3ac6dc98b468f5798b37ac6a6eeeb49facd9f:11

value
89756845
script pubkey
OP_0 OP_PUSHBYTES_32 23472ee85eead12cc181a2a8c802a7439a77046d58f780640d0e92794db51a39
address
bc1qydrja6z7atgjesvp525vsq48gwd8wprdtrmcqeqdp6f8jnd4rgusz66esj
transaction
95bce2465c3bdc97e1b23f34b5b3ac6dc98b468f5798b37ac6a6eeeb49facd9f
confirmations
277876
spent
true